大数据项目的实施是一项复杂而多步骤的过程,涉及从需求分析到数据收集、存储、处理、分析以及最终的数据应用。以下是一份基于国内工具和实践的大数据项目实施指南:
1. 项目启动与规划
- 需求分析:与客户沟通以确定项目目标和预期成果。进行市场调研,理解行业趋势。
- 制定计划:根据需求制定详细的项目计划,包括时间表、预算、资源分配等。
2. 数据获取与整合
- 数据源识别:确定数据来源(内部系统、第三方服务、公共数据集等)。
- 数据清洗:去除重复、不完整或错误的数据。
- 数据集成:使用etl(抽取、转换、加载)工具将不同来源的数据整合到一个中心数据库中。
3. 数据处理与存储
- 数据仓库建设:选择合适的数据仓库技术如hadoop、amazon redshift等。
- 数据管理:确保数据的一致性、安全性和可访问性。
- 数据备份:定期备份数据,以防数据丢失。
4. 数据分析与挖掘
- 统计分析:利用统计方法分析数据模式和趋势。
- 机器学习:使用机器学习算法对数据进行预测和分类。
- 数据可视化:通过图表和图形展示分析结果,帮助决策者理解数据。
5. 项目实施与监控
- 开发阶段:按照敏捷方法论分步开发,及时反馈并调整方案。
- 测试阶段:进行单元测试、集成测试和性能测试,确保系统稳定可靠。
- 部署上线:将系统部署到生产环境,并进行压力测试和稳定性验证。
6. 维护与更新
- 系统监控:实时监控系统状态,及时发现并解决故障。
- 性能优化:根据用户反馈和业务变化持续优化系统性能。
- 数据更新:定期更新数据,保证分析结果的准确性。
7. 风险管理与合规性
- 风险评估:识别项目可能面临的风险,并制定应对策略。
- 法规遵守:遵循相关法律、政策和行业标准。
- 应急预案:准备应对数据泄露、系统故障等紧急情况的预案。
8. 培训与支持
- 用户培训:为用户提供必要的培训,确保他们能够有效使用系统。
- 技术支持:提供技术支持,解决用户在使用过程中遇到的问题。
9. 项目评估与总结
- 效果评估:评估项目是否达到预期目标,收集用户反馈。
- 经验总结:总结项目成功经验和教训,为未来类似项目提供参考。
关键要素
- 明确的目标和范围:确保项目有清晰的目标和合理的时间线。
- 跨部门协作:加强团队间的沟通与合作,确保项目顺利进行。
- 灵活应变:在遇到问题时保持灵活性,及时调整策略。
- 持续学习与改进:项目过程中不断学习新技术和方法,提高项目质量。
大数据项目的实施是一个迭代过程,需要不断地评估、调整和完善。通过上述步骤和关键要素的实践,可以有效地推动大数据项目的成功实施。